class RideCreateInputSerializer(serializers.Serializer):
"""Input serializer for creating rides."""
name = serializers.CharField(max_length=255)
description = serializers.CharField(allow_blank=True, default="")
category = serializers.ChoiceField(choices=ModelChoices.get_ride_category_choices())
status = serializers.ChoiceField(
choices=ModelChoices.get_ride_status_choices(), default="OPERATING"
)
# Required park
park_id = serializers.IntegerField()
# Optional area
park_area_id = serializers.IntegerField(required=False, allow_null=True)
# Optional dates
opening_date = serializers.DateField(required=False, allow_null=True)
closing_date = serializers.DateField(required=False, allow_null=True)
status_since = serializers.DateField(required=False, allow_null=True)
# Optional specs
min_height_in = serializers.IntegerField(
required=False, allow_null=True, min_value=30, max_value=90
)
max_height_in = serializers.IntegerField(
required=False, allow_null=True, min_value=30, max_value=90
)
capacity_per_hour = serializers.IntegerField(
required=False, allow_null=True, min_value=1
)
ride_duration_seconds = serializers.IntegerField(
required=False, allow_null=True, min_value=1
)
# Optional companies
manufacturer_id = serializers.IntegerField(required=False, allow_null=True)
designer_id = serializers.IntegerField(required=False, allow_null=True)
# Optional model
ride_model_id = serializers.IntegerField(required=False, allow_null=True)
def validate(self, attrs):
"""Cross-field validation."""
# Date validation
opening_date = attrs.get("opening_date")
closing_date = attrs.get("closing_date")
if opening_date and closing_date and closing_date < opening_date:
raise serializers.ValidationError(
"Closing date cannot be before opening date"
)
# Height validation
min_height = attrs.get("min_height_in")
max_height = attrs.get("max_height_in")
if min_height and max_height and min_height > max_height:
raise serializers.ValidationError(
"Minimum height cannot be greater than maximum height"
)
# Park area validation when park changes
park_id = attrs.get("park_id")
park_area_id = attrs.get("park_area_id")
if park_id and park_area_id:
try:
from apps.parks.models import ParkArea
park_area = ParkArea.objects.get(id=park_area_id)
if park_area.park_id != park_id:
raise serializers.ValidationError(
f"Park area '{park_area.name}' does not belong to the selected park"
)
except Exception:
# If models aren't available or area doesn't exist, let the view handle it
pass
return attrs

class RideReviewCreateInputSerializer(serializers.Serializer):
"""Input serializer for creating ride reviews."""
ride_id = serializers.IntegerField()
rating = serializers.IntegerField(min_value=1, max_value=10)
title = serializers.CharField(max_length=200)
content = serializers.CharField()
visit_date = serializers.DateField()
def validate_visit_date(self, value):
"""Validate visit date is not in the future."""
from django.utils import timezone
if value > timezone.now().date():
raise serializers.ValidationError("Visit date cannot be in the future")
return value
